At 0.92, CBS Sports sits at the top of ESPN Radio's neighbor set — but the more revealing structural fact is that the audience bridges two distinct clusters: former NFL players turned analysts, and sports media channels.

The shape is two-peak. One cluster is anchored by athletes-turned-commentators: Mark Schlereth (0.90), Cris Carter (0.89), Trent Dilfer (0.86), Mike Golic (0.85), and Cris Collinsworth (0.85) all carry the Athletes subcategory. The second cluster is sports media infrastructure: The Will Cain Show (0.89) and Keyshawn, JWill & Zubin (0.88) are fellow Podcasts and Radio entries, while NCAA March Madness (0.85) rounds out the broadcast-adjacent tier. Jim Rome (0.85) is the lone Journalist in the top 10, sitting between the two clusters as a sports-talk figure who straddles both.

Notably, ESPN Radio's own subcategory — Podcasts and Radio — accounts for only two of the ten neighbors. The dominant pull is Athletes, with five entries, suggesting the audience's shape is defined less by the radio format itself and more by the specific on-air talent ecosystem of former professional football players doing commentary work.

That pattern points to an audience whose composition is tightly organized around NFL-adjacent voices, regardless of the medium those voices appear in.
